logo

Output 23acc60f1ec4fc3047c3398daf599e7b39e7c04e50070fa436c0b73f4ef769a9:1

value
138890000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66e10d4f2b65215ec803af87717da317de24af88 OP_EQUALVERIFY OP_CHECKSIG
address
1ANyXTH4hdZ1Uf8tVkztgcnaRdFhNT7s2o
transaction
23acc60f1ec4fc3047c3398daf599e7b39e7c04e50070fa436c0b73f4ef769a9